Programme Overview
The Certificate in Geomagnetic Field Simulation Methods is designed for professionals and students in the fields of geophysics, environmental science, and engineering who aim to deepen their understanding and skills in simulating and analyzing geomagnetic phenomena. This program equips learners with advanced knowledge and practical skills in using sophisticated models and computational tools to simulate the Earth's magnetic field and its interactions with various environmental and technological systems. Through this comprehensive program, participants will learn to apply mathematical and computational techniques to model geomagnetic field variations, understand the underlying physical processes, and interpret complex data sets.
Learners will develop key skills in geophysical modeling, including the use of software tools such as MATLAB and Python for data processing and analysis, and the application of numerical methods to solve differential equations that govern geomagnetic field behavior. They will also gain proficiency in interpreting and visualizing magnetic field data, as well as in conducting research that contributes to the broader understanding of geomagnetic phenomena. Why This Course
Professionals in geophysics and space science can significantly enhance their career prospects by obtaining a Certificate in Geomagnetic Field Simulation Methods. This certification equips them with the advanced knowledge and practical skills necessary to model and analyze geomagnetic phenomena, which are crucial for understanding space weather and its impacts on technological systems.
The certificate provides specialized training in software tools and simulation techniques used in geomagnetic field studies. This not only helps professionals to predict geomagnetic storms but also aids in the development of mitigation strategies to protect satellites and power grids from potential disruptions.
By acquiring expertise in geomagnetic field simulation, professionals can contribute to interdisciplinary research and development projects. For instance, they can collaborate with engineers in designing more resilient communication and navigation systems that can withstand adverse space weather conditions. This cross-disciplinary approach enhances their value in the workforce and opens up opportunities in diverse sectors such as aerospace, telecommunications, and environmental monitoring.
